Understanding Hypoallergenic Products
Before we discuss whether silicone nipple covers are hypoallergenic, let's first understand what the term "hypoallergenic" means. Hypoallergenic products are designed to minimize the risk of causing an allergic reaction. They are formulated with materials and ingredients that are less likely to trigger an immune response in the body. However, it's important to note that no product can be guaranteed 100% hypoallergenic, as individual sensitivities can vary widely.

Why Silicone is Considered Hypoallergenic
There are several reasons why silicone is often considered hypoallergenic:
- Inertness: Silicone is a chemically inert material, which means it does not react with other substances easily. This reduces the likelihood of it causing an allergic reaction when it comes into contact with the skin.
- Low Porosity: Silicone has a low porosity, which means it does not absorb or retain moisture easily. This helps to prevent the growth of bacteria and fungi, which can cause skin irritation and infections.
- Hypoallergenic Properties: Silicone has been extensively tested for its hypoallergenic properties. Clinical studies have shown that it is well-tolerated by most people, even those with sensitive skin.
Factors That Can Affect Hypoallergenicity
While silicone nipple covers are generally considered hypoallergenic, there are some factors that can affect their hypoallergenicity:
- Individual Sensitivities: As mentioned earlier, individual sensitivities can vary widely. Some people may be allergic to silicone or other materials used in the nipple covers, even if they are generally considered hypoallergenic.
- Quality of the Silicone: The quality of the silicone used in the nipple covers can also affect their hypoallergenicity. Low-quality silicone may contain impurities or additives that can cause skin irritation or allergic reactions.
- Proper Use and Care: Proper use and care of the nipple covers are also important for maintaining their hypoallergenicity. It's important to follow the manufacturer's instructions for cleaning and storing the nipple covers to prevent the growth of bacteria and fungi.

Patch Testing
A patch test is a simple and effective way to determine whether you are allergic to a particular product. To do a patch test, apply a small amount of the product to a small area of your skin, such as the inside of your wrist or elbow. Leave the product on your skin for 24 to 48 hours and observe for any signs of redness, itching, swelling, or other skin reactions. If you experience any of these symptoms, do not use the product.
